文献信息

  • CURABLE COMPOSITION AND CURED ARTICLE
    申请人:Adeka Corporation
    公开号:EP2749581A1
    公开(公告)日:2014-07-02
    Provided are: a curable composition from which a cured article having excellent molding processability and high heat resistance as well as such a high Tg that it can be used as a molding resin for a SiC power semiconductor can be obtained; and a cured article thereof. The curable composition comprises: 100 parts by mass of a compound having at least two partial structures represented by the following Formula (1) in the molecule as a component (A); 0.5 to 3 parts by mass of a thermal radical generator as a component (B); and 0 to 50 parts by mass of other radical-reactive compound as a component (C): (wherein, ring A represents a benzene ring or a cyclohexyl ring; R1 represents an alkylene group having 1 to 6 carbon atoms; R2 represents an alkyl group having 1 to 4 carbon atoms; a represents a number of 0 or 1; b represents an integer of 0 to 3; and c represents a number of 1 or 2).
    本发明提供了:一种可固化组合物,通过该组合物可以获得一种固化物,该固化物具有优异的成型加工性和高耐热性,并且具有很高的 Tg,可以用作碳化硅功率半导体的成型树脂;以及一种固化物。固化组合物包括100 份(质量)分子中至少有两个部分结构由下式 (1) 表示的化合物作为组分 (A); 0.5 至 3 份(质量)热自由基发生器作为组分 (B);以及 0 至 50 份(质量)其他自由基反应化合物作为组分 (C): (其中,环 A 代表苯环或环己基环;R1 代表具有 1 至 6 个碳原子的亚烷基;R2 代表具有 1 至 4 个碳原子的烷基;a 代表 0 或 1;b 代表 0 至 3 的整数;c 代表 1 或 2)。
  • Polycarbonate polyol compositions and methods
    申请人:Saudi Aramco Technologies Company
    公开号:US10301426B2
    公开(公告)日:2019-05-28
    In one aspect, the present disclosure encompasses polymerization systems for the copolymerization of CO2 and epoxides comprising 1) a catalyst including a metal coordination compound having a permanent ligand set and at least one ligand that is a polymerization initiator, and 2) a chain transfer agent having two or more sites that can initiate polymerization. In a second aspect, the present disclosure encompasses methods for the synthesis of polycarbonate polyols using the inventive polymerization systems. In a third aspect, the present disclosure encompasses polycarbonate polyol compositions characterized in that the polymer chains have a high percentage of —OH end groups and a high percentage of carbonate linkages. The compositions are further characterized in that they contain polymer chains having an embedded polyfunctional moiety linked to a plurality of individual polycarbonate chains.
    在一个方面,本发明公开了用于二氧化碳和环氧化物共聚的聚合体系,该体系包括:1)催化剂,包括具有永久配位体的金属配位化合物和至少一种作为聚合引发剂的配位体;2)链转移剂,该链转移剂具有两个或两个以上可引发聚合的位点。第二方面,本公开包括使用本发明聚合体系合成聚碳酸酯多元醇的方法。第三方面,本公开包括聚碳酸酯多元醇组合物,其特征在于聚合物链具有高比例的 -OH 端基和高比例的碳酸酯链节。这些组合物的进一步特征在于,它们含有与多个单独的聚碳酸酯链连接的嵌入式多官能团的聚合物链。
